This is not configurable. They have a simple, intuitive design, and the learning curve is not big: Its available everywhere and works smoothly. An avid technology media consumer, with a keen interest in topics related to digital marketing, fintech and productivity. Editor at TechLoot. Question#1: I am not sure how to setup the Portainer Environment setting ? Jellyfish Remote Access is a service that allows you to connect your Jellyfish to the internet, and then access it remotely through the Connect App as if you were in your office. A Volumio plugin for playing audio from one or more Jellyfin servers. Therefore, for instance in the Android app, the Host setting must include the BaseURL as well (e.g. If you add up the costs, its starting to look like going back to the days of buying Blu-ray discs might not have been such a bad idea, after all. In my experience, the single biggest barrier to entry for new users (especially people like me with pretty limited technical experience) is that - by default - Jellyfin runs without encryption and is unreachable from outside your local network. This post written with some feedback by the Tailscale team after I participated in a survey, but it is not sponsored by Tailscale. When Jellyfin connects to services such as TVDB, it can fetch episode names and other information in your local language if it is available. It's possible to run Jellyfin behind another server acting as a reverse proxy. Why not use a dynamic dns service to point to your network and port forwarding? The linked guides rules are pretty restrictive, so use your judgement when deciding which rules to use on your system. We do our best to stay on top of the latest in tech so that you dont have to search the entire internet for what you are looking for. If you want to allow remote access to your media server you can set up a port forward which will direct the correct traffic to your media server. But lately, Plex has heavily leaned on its own free media service, and its impossible to escape it in any app. An official plugin for Mopidy that uses Jellyfin as a backend. 7. I didnt see any guides about setting up remote access to Jellyfin using Tailscale or similar, so heres mine! Cannot add shared folder in Jellyfin #4834 - GitHub Hostname: yourname.synology.me. OWC Jellyfish Remote Access A broadcast message to this port with Who is JellyfinServer? You can find the default ports below to access the web frontend. You have several guides to set it up on the internet. Don't worry about step 5 (secure the server); we'll get to that. . Thanks for sharing some valuable post. Followers 1. How to Install Jellyfin Media Server on Linux Mint 21 or 20 That's why I am now trying to get Jellyfin to work. This should be kept in mind when removing an existing Base URL. The process to do this is a little bit involved, but well worth it if youre going to use your Jellyfin server outside your home on a regular basis. A third-party Android application for Jellyfin that provides a native user interface to browse and play movies and series. Lastly, lets talk about Plex, the elephant in the room. Remote Access Tailscale 5.00 Create Jellyfin Remote Access Users. In order for a reverse proxy to have the maximum benefit, you should have a publicly routable IP address and a domain with DNS set up correctly. Generally, passing / back to the Jellyfin instance will work fine in all cases and the paths will be normalized, and this is the standard configuration in our examples. You will be required to set up a login account to begin using your server and specify which folders contain your media files. Instead of using streaming services where you have to pay a monthly fee, savvy network gurus are deploying Plex, Jellyfin, Emby, and other self-hosted media systems on their home network. The official Jellyfin app for Android devices. I only needed to open up the 443/80 ports to allow remote access. This is the binding for Jellyfin the volunteer-built media solution that puts you in control of your media. ago. And, most impressively, you can go to the Plugins section to add a vast array of new functionality to the Jellyfin app. I alone didnt know anything about setting this kind of things before but I was guided through whole process by ChatGPT. Dont forget to add rules for any other services (e.g., mosh, syncthing, etc.) Press J to jump to the feed. Turn on Allow remote connections to this server, and set it to work on a Blacklist. That was pretty cool, but what if I wasnt home? Share More sharing options. This is not configurable. If you havent noticed by now, theres almost no end to the ways you can customize Jellyfin, and its a piece of software thats under development and is evolving all the time. Tons of guides out there. You can create individual users specifically for remote access for use on smartphones, tablets and notebook. Some popular options for reverse proxy systems are Apache, Caddy, Haproxy, Nginx and Traefik. , There are other equally viable reverse-proxy options, like Apache, Nginx, and Traefik. Normally residential IPs are dynamic and will change over time so you will have to set up a DDNS (dynamic DNS). Jellyfin provides a guide for using Caddy as a reverse proxy, but it will not enable HTTPS. In this video, I . Install Jellyfin Media Server Linux Mint 20 - LinuxCapable My container had a sample config for jellyfin ready to go so I was ready to go in maybe 10 minutes. For consumers, that means facing the prospect of fragmentation, which could mean having to spring for a handful of new subscriptions in the coming months. It's pretty good because it allows you to set up your own domain name so you don't have to remember any numbers. But if ssl is not enabled everyone can see your traffic (and I think it's case by default), medium & secure: port forward ssh instead of 8096 on the router. Many clients will automatically discover servers running on the same LAN and display them on login. In order for Chromecast to work on a non-public routable connection, 8.8.8.8 must be blocked on the Chromecast's Gateway. They are generally not built into most router's firmware, but it's worth the effort to build the needed infrastructure. After you download the Jellyfin app for your iPhone, iPad, Apple TV, or smart TV (Jellyfin has great apps for popular smart TV brands), your media will populate, ready for wireless streaming, as long as youre on the same wifi network. Reverse Proxy and HTTPS. Keep it up. The Definitive Guide to Jellyfin | Plus Top 10 Must-Have Plugins! Jellyfin features a demo server that enables users to test the software before installing it. GitHub. In a sign that the entertainment industry thinks theres no such thing as too much of a bad thing there are even several more streaming services about to launch in the very near future. Note that the Magic DNS configuration requires specifying port 80 since Caddy tries to automatically set up HTTPS. A third party remote control for Jellyfin with support for Chromecast playback. Tailscale is the solution for me, and should work for your parents as well, I just finished setting it up :D I used nginx as reverse proxy for this with built in router DDNS and freedns.afraid.org as dns service (I just wanted to access it by jellyfin.domain.com), And I have ONE great advice for you. Through the browser? By rejecting non-essential cookies, Reddit may still use certain cookies to ensure the proper functionality of our platform. I dont think you will be able to use HTTPS just yet, but I think a new Tailscale feature will address this in the near future. The one place Plex does have an edge is its remote network feature, which lets you access your library from anywhere, and lets you share your collection with your friends. Get the benefits of cloud without cloud limitations. The window below will open. Tap the Settings (gear) icon in the lower right corner, and select Add Files. Tailscale works seamlessly with a dynamic IP without the need for a DDNS solution, and does not require port forwarding or opening to function. Shop sales in every category.Uh-oh, overstock: Wayfair put their surplus on sale for up to 50% off. This is a comma separated list of IP addresses/hostnames of known proxies used when connecting to your Jellyfin instance and is required to make proper use of X-Forwarded-For headers. How to host a Jellyfin server on Windows Server Tailscale assigns each device an IP address in the 100.x.y.z range. Nebula has a great set-up guide by Ars Technica, but its slower than Wireguard and not as polished. A music client inspired by players such as foobar2000 or Clementine. I belive its the greatest use case for him. Installing Jellyfin - Docker - openmediavault It looks like you've put a lot of work into this. The server will select an unused port on startup to connect to these tuner devices. Since we are using a reverse proxy, Jellyfin is already accessed over ports 80 and 443; theres no need to add a special rule for it. How to set up the Jellyfin media server on Linux - AddictiveTips I only needed to open up the 443/80 ports to allow remote access. It isnt a pipe dream: You can actually build your own streaming network that hosts all the shows, movies, and music you already ownall you need to enter the world of media servers is enough hard drive space, a PC, and a stable internet connection. Where can I find my ip? A full-featured Subsonic/Jellyfin compatible desktop music player. For instance, accessing a server with a Base URL of /jellyfin on the / path will automatically append the /jellyfin Base URL. will get a JSON response that includes the server address, ID, and name. Add the IP address/hostname of your reverse proxy to the Known Proxies (under Admin Dashboard -> Networking). Doesn't cloudflare forbid this? A lightweight Kodi add-on that lets you browse and play media files directly from your Jellyfin server within the Kodi interface. Enable the VPN with, If you want to access your server via a subdomain like. See monitoring for details on the monitoring endpoints that Jellyfin provides. Thank you, it's working fine now and I'm using noip cos my home ip is dynamic. Pick from three different membership levels to choose how you want to support us!You'll be given an instant Discord role to match your donations, completely automated. There are some alternatives to Tailscale you might consider as I did, namely plain Wireguard, ZeroTier, and Nebula. There are three main caveats to this setting. Right now, the only mobile app the Jellyfin developers have ready to go is for Android-based devices, but the web browser access mentioned above works well on iOS and most other mobile operating systems. Create an account to follow your favorite communities and start taking part in conversations. A Discord bot by KGT1 that allows playing your Jellyfin music library in Discord voice channels. The nginx documentation below includes an example how to censor sensitive information from a logfile. I enabled it in settings but this still doesn't work. Step 2. Enabling this setting seems to have fixed the problem, at least testing with the mobile app over VPN, remotely. I succeeded in installing jellyfin. This setting requires a server restart to change, in order to avoid invalidating existing paths until the administrator is ready. I am following this guide: Example of installing an application Jellyfin ( [How to] Prepare OMV to install docker applications) but struggle with some simple concepts. Jellyfin lets you watch your media from a web browser on your computer, apps on your Roku, Android, iOS (including AirPlay), Android TV, or Fire TV device, or via your Chromecast or existing Kodi installation. Turn on "Allow remote connections to this server", and set it to work on a Blacklist. Ports 80 and 443 (pointing to the proxy server) need to be opened on your router and firewall. Jellyfin sometimes sends authentication information as part of the URL (e.g api_key parameter), so logging the full request path can expose secrets to your logfile. from /baseurl to /newbaseurl), the Jellyfin web server will automatically handle redirects to avoid displaying users invalid pages. Everything from client apps, local and remote streaming, Live TV & DVR to plug-ins and library sharing is completely free. If you want to be able to access Jellyfin while youre away from home, all you have to do is forward port 8096 on your homes internet router to your Jellyfin server, and connect via your public IP address (which you can find out by going here). If you have a certificate from another source, change the SSL configuration from /etc/letsencrypt/DOMAIN_NAME/ to the location of your certificate and key. On the next page, you must choose your "Preferred Metadata Language." Choose your language and country if it is not already detected. @swust said in Access Jellyfin server on different subnet: I can't ping the jellyfin IP. Our site uses cookies. You don't have to pay a dime to use Jellyfin or access its entire stack of features. Rn I am using ngrok but it's a hassle because the link keeps changing. I use it and its literally just one line to reverse proxy my installcaddy --reverse-proxy netfelix:8096 mysite, https://jellyfin.org/docs/general/administration/reverse-proxy.html, basic: you need your home ip and port forward as you wrote. Press question mark to learn the rest of the keyboard shortcuts. Best of all. The process to do this is a little bit involved, but well worth it if you . Jellyfin Remote Access with Tailscale . Nginx. Get our free server to collect all your audio, video, photos, and more in one place. The Jellyfin project is an open source, free software media server. dynu.com works out great for me. However, entirely removing a Base URL (i.e. Thats how I decided on Tailscale, and Im happy with my choice so far. Plus, you can get a personalized domain name for your server so you wont have to remember its IP address all the time. Open the Start menu and search for Jellyfin. The only thing we do recommend you get are large, reliable, NAS-grade hard drives if you plan you keep your PC running for days at a time (because spinning hard drives have a habit of failing randomly). Go to solution Solved by MicrowaveGaming, January 14. I find it easier to set up than a VPN and the performance is fantastic. That means its going to keep getting better as the developers add more and more features with each new version. Once added, youll need to enter your OpenSubtitles username, passcode, and an API, which you can get from the OpenSubtitles account page. Tailscale & DNS. Once this is working yiu can buy a domain or use a free one remeber to set up https, else your ligin credentials could be stolen. Best of all, there are active and thriving user communities filled will people that can help you to customize your server to do almost anything you need. You can change this in the dashboard. you can safely skip TLS use that guide and skip setting up TLS if youre short on time. im not too familiar with reverse proxies, but would something like an nginxreverseproxy be a solution? Jellyfin is an open source alternative for Plex, and here's how to Device hostnames will also soon be renamable, in case youd prefer to access your server another way. We're also throwing in the top 10 must-have plugins to get the best experience out of your free and open-source media server!Written doc right here: https://docs.ibracorp.io/jellyfin/============= CHAPTERS ================0:00 Intro1:53 Jellyfin5:58 Install on Unraid8:50 Install with Docker Compose11:03 Configure Jellyfin14:47 Best Settings15:28 Top Plugins18:55 Libraries20:45 Transcoder Settings22:47 Tips \u0026 Tricks25:19 Testing it Out27:24 Next Video Preview============= LINKS ================You can find all of our links on the IBRAHUBhttps://ibracorp.io/ibrahub============= MERCH ================ Looking for our merch?